CHAPTER ONE
HYPOTHETICAL WOLF

✦✧✦✧✦

Melissa McCall wasn't one to ask for help. So when her husband came home every night and basically sucked the liquor cabinet dry and lashed out frequently, she didn't know who to turn to.

She first noticed a problem when Violet came home one day and showed her mother a drawing of their family.

"There's Scotty, mommy, me, and daddy." Violet pointed out to Melissa.

"Sweetheart it's beautiful. But why is daddy holding a bottle? He's not a baby." Melissa asked her daughter with a slight chuckle in her voice.

"Daddy always has a bottle in his hand when he gets home. So I drew it with him." Violet explained.

Melissa's final straw, however, was when she and Rafael had gotten into an argument and Scott had been at the wrong place at the wrong time.

Rafael had grabbed Scott and pushed him down the stairs. Angered by his accident, he chucked his bottle of alcohol to the ground where Violet now stood, looking for the source of commotion. Some glass embedded itself into the then three-year old's arm, and her brother was knocked unconscious at the foot of the stairs.

After assuring that the children were okay, Melissa made the decision that it would be best for the kids and herself if Rafael went to get some help and stayed away for a little while.

It had been 12 years since Violet had last seen her father.

The youngest McCall had often tried to remember her father, but was reminded that what her mother did was for the best when she would trace over the scar that she liked to call her parting gift, it held a small piece of glass from the bottle inside her arm.

It was very early on in her life when Violet decided that she wanted to become a nurse like her mom. Violet McCall would do anything to help her friends and family.

Although Melissa always encouraged her daughter to pursue being a doctor instead, as a little girl, Violet said she wanted to work with her mother in nursing.

Violet thought about that night as she boredly traced over her arm in pen during class. One more year until I get my internship at the hospital! Thought Violet excitedly.

Due to lack of teachers for the freshmen, Violet was stuck taking Mr. Harris' class with Scott, Stiles, and Jackson—or as she liked to call him—Jackass.

"McCall?" Harris called.

Both Scott and Violet had absently said they were present and Harris did not look excited to have the siblings in his class. He didn't like the fact that both Scott and Violet were in the same class. Of course he didn't, it was Mr. Harris. "Now I'm stuck with both McCall's in the same period. Sit next to Stilinski," he gestured to Violet, "maybe then he'll be able to control himself."

Violet stood from her seat next to her brother and picked up her things before going behind Scott to sit with Stiles.

"Take it up with the main office, don't complain to me. I merely was just given my schedule and I showed up." Violet said after she heard his little comment, heads turned towards the younger McCall and her brother tossed her a look, to which she replied to with a sassy smile.

✦✧✦

At the end of the day, there were lacrosse try outs and Scott and Stiles were trying to make first line—well, Scott anyway. Stiles was exceptionally bad at the sport.

Sitting by the back end of the bleachers, Violet saw the girl that her brother was fawning over as well as the girl who had complimented her at the beginning of the day, her name was Lydia and Violet had found out she was the most popular girl in school, who, unfortunately, had been dating Jackson: Captain of the Lacrosse team.

Scott turned to face the bleachers and smiled at someone near Violet, which she mistook as her brother smiling at her instead of the girl behind her.

Violet waved at her brother, but when he didn't wave back, she looked behind her and saw the girl that had stolen Scott's attention, the girl was smiling back at Scott and waved to him. When Scott waved back, the lacrosse coach asked if he had a question with his booming voice and he was pulled out of his trance.

The youngest McCall became curious. Seeing Stiles at the bottom of the bleachers, Violet made her way down the bleachers and plopped herself next to the short haired spastic boy. "Stiles!" She exclaimed when she sat down, naturally making him jump.

"Oh, my god! Don't scare me like that. Jesus. What is it?" He asked.

"Who was Scott staring at this morning when I came up to you guys in the hallway?" Violet inquired.

"Her name is Allison. I think Scotty's obsessed. She's new and is already part of Lydia's clique. It's like Harley was saying, new girl's here all of five minutes and Lydia's already pouncing. Lydia talked to you more this morning than she's ever talked to me." Stiles complained.

"If you're struggling that much, just pay someone to date you." Violet replied, looking up at Allison. She was pretty, she had to admit. With her long, dark hair and an unforgettable smile, Allison seemed like a positive thing that could happen in her brother's life.

"Oh, by the way, I want my iPod back. Broken or not..." Violet said, getting up to go back to her spot when Stiles grabbed her arm when he realized something.

"If I pay you to date me do I have to get you a new iPod?" Stiles asked, a hopeful look in his eyes.

"I—" she paused, "I'm not fake dating you!" Violet exclaimed. Although hesitant to be honest, she had had a crush on Stiles for almost a year, then she realized she was being insane, "I want my iPod back." She repeated before tugging her arm free and going back to where she sat by Allison and Lydia.

"Does that mean you wouldn't date me at all?" Stiles asked across the bleachers.

"Yes!" Violet yelled back as if Stiles was crazy.

As she sat down, Violet picked up a piece of a conversation, "do you know who that is?" A girl asked, it could've been Allison.

"I'm not sure who he is. Why?" Definitely Lydia replied.

"He's in my English class." Allison replied.

Violet squealed a bit on the inside at the possible thought that a girl had a crush on her brother.

✦✧✦

After Scott and Violet had gotten home, Scott was right out again, getting a ride from Stiles to go somewhere. Scott hadn't specified. Hating to be the tag along, but not wanting to bike to the hospital, Violet asked Stiles to take her to the hospital to bring her mother some lunch since Scott never did the honors.

Violet walked through the hospital doors and saw her mother at the front desk, "hey, mom!" She called, placing the plastic bag on the desk when she reached her mother.

"Is my daughter actually bringing me lunch?" Melissa asked in a shocked tone as she took the bag and gave her daughter a kiss, "thank you. Is Scott buying dinner tonight?"

"No problem, he asked me for some money—that I don't have, by the way." Violet explained, but shrugged.

Melissa reached in her pocket and pulled out her wallet, and slipping a 20 dollar bill into Violet's hand and winking before walking into a back room with the lunch bag.

Violet walked outside while slipping the 20 in her pocket and Scott hopped out of the Jeep to let her in. After making her way in and Scott closed the door, Stiles drove off. They headed to the Beacon Hills Preserve. The boys had failed to tell Violet why, though.

As the teens trudged through the woods, Scott and Stiles spoke about the body he found in the woods and his inhaler, along with a list of new so-called abilities he had acquired. "You lost your inhaler?! Mom's gonna be pissed. Maybe you can get the wolf to explain it to her, spidey."

"What if it's like an infection?" Scott asked when they finally reached Beacon Hills Preserve, searching for Scott's missing inhaler. "Like...my body is full of adrenaline before I go into shock or something?"

"You know what, I actually think I've heard of it... It's a specific kind of infection." Stiles mentioned.

"Oh, god. The worst thing you guys could do is self diagnose, it just leads to you guys doing everything wrong. Also, never WebMD anything. It all just leads to cancer." Violet added.

"You're serious?" Scott asked.

"I think it's called Lycanthropy." Stiles said, to which Violet responded with a snort and a burst of laughter.

"Good one." She laughed while pointing at Stiles.

"What?" Scott asked, obviously not understanding, "is that bad?"

"Oh, yeah. It's horrible." Violet replied.

"It's only once a month, though. So it's not all bad." Stiles said.

"Once a month?" Scott asked, beginning to question level of seriousness his best friend had on the subject matter.

"Uh-huh. On a full moon." Stiles said seriously, then followed up with a howling sound. Scott's worried face turned into anger as he shoved Stiles backwards.
"Hey, you're the one who heard a wolf howling."

"We should be allowed to poke a little fun." Violet said, looking on the ground for Scott's inhaler.

"It's not funny, there could be something seriously wrong with me!" Scott exclaimed.

"I know! You're a werewolf!" Stiles replied, "okay, obviously I'm kidding. But if you see me trying to melt all the silver I can find it's because Friday is the full moon."

"I dropped it right before I got bitten by—" Scott started, ignoring Stiles' remark.

"The hypothetical wolf." Violet interrupted, putting air quotes around 'wolf'.

"I swear it was real! Now help me look for my inhaler." Scott exclaimed, crouching down. "I swear it was right here." He mumbled, waving his hands around on the ground, pushing past the leaves that resided in his way.

"Maybe the killer moved this body you two are babbling about." Violet suggested.

"If he did, I hope he didn't take my inhaler, those things are like 80 bucks." Scott replied.

Violet looked to the side and saw someone standing there, just observing. She tapped Stiles on his arm and he looked up, and practically jumped upon seeing the man. Stiles nudged Scott, and Scott looked up looking rather confused, but Stiles pulled him up to his feet.

"What are you doing here, huh? This is private property." The man spat, his attitude was higher than a pubescent teen's.

"Uh, sorry man. We didn't know." Stiles spoke up.

"We were just looking for something, but, forget it." Scott mumbled, only to be stopped by his sister.

"No way, I'm not letting you put a dent in our already declining money supply." Violet spoke up, then turned to the man, "did you see an inhaler anywhere? My brother dropped it last night."

Without another word, just a look from the man, he tossed Scott's inhaler to him, which he caught. When they turned around to thank him, he was gone.

"Okay, I have to get to work." Scott said, checking the time.

"Dude, that was Derek Hale! You remember him, right? He's only a few years older than us." Stiles asked Scott as they started walking back to the jeep.

"Remember what?" Both Scott and Violet asked.

"Okay, one. Never do that again, it's just creepy. And two, his family. They all burned to death in a fire like ten years ago."

"Well, what's he doing back?" Violet asked.

"Don't know...come on. I feel like your second mom. Scott, I'm taking you to work, and Vi, I'm taking you to...where am I taking you?"

"Wherever you're going. I have no plans....or friends." Violet trailed off.

✦✧✦

The next morning, Violet knocked on Scott's door to wake him up as she went downstairs to make breakfast. When Scott never came downstairs, his sister became worried.

Knocking again before opening it, Violet saw that her brother's bed was empty as could be with no sign of Scott anywhere. Her first instinct was to call Stiles.

"What is it, Vi? I just got up." Stiles whined over the phone.

"Scott's not in his bed." Violet explained.

"What do you mean, not in his bed? Did he leave early?"

"No. I woke up, knocked on his door, and went to make breakfast. I would've heard him go through the front door if he left."

"Don't worry about it, I'll find him." Stiles reassured before hanging up.

After school, there was another lacrosse meet as there was every day after school. Violet waited for her brother and Stiles.

When she saw them, Scott was far ahead and Stiles was trailing behind. Stiles looked up at the bleachers and saw Violet sitting there, he smiled at her and she gave a small wave back as he and Scott made their way to the field.

On the field, coach talked about things to get them hyped up for first line, a spot everyone strived to get, "You know how this goes. If you don't make the cut, you stay on the bleachers for the rest of the season. You make the cut, you're playing! Your parents are proud. Your girlfriend loves you! Now get out there and show me what you've got!" Finstock exclaimed, blowing his whistle as everyone spread out on the field.

Stiles looked up at the bleachers and saw Violet sitting there, observing the players closely. Mostly her brother, Scott, but her eyes scoured the field until they landed on the boy who had been staring back her. Stiles immediately looked away and turned around awkwardly and very unsubtly.

If Scott found out his best friend had a crush on his sister, that could mean the end of their friendship.
